Experience the thrill of watching Waikiki’s Friday night fireworks from a glass-bottom boat during this 1-hour cruise along Honolulu's skyline. Located in Hawaii, you'll be treated to an exciting view as your journey begins.
Getting Started
Please arrive at least 15 minutes early at the Hawaii Glass Bottom Boats dock for check-in with the crew before boarding. Following a brief safety briefing, enjoy complimentary water or juice while waiting for departure towards the fireworks viewing area.
What to Expect on Your Cruise
This Friday evening cruise offers an exceptional perspective of Honolulu’s city lights and its weekly fireworks display from the waterside. Enjoy unique views beneath you through glass-bottom viewports illuminated by underwater lighting, showcasing marine life along your route.
Features Highlighted During Your Waikiki Fireworks Cruise
- Catch panoramic skyline vistas of Honolulu’s glowing cityscape and the dazzling Friday night fireworks from an open deck.
- The glass-bottom boat is equipped with underwater lights, offering a distinctive look at Hawaii's marine world through transparent panels as you cruise.
- Onboard amenities include complimentary water and juice. You also have access to coolers filled with ice for your personal snacks or drinks.
- You are welcome to bring along your own refreshments, allowing you to customize your experience while enjoying the celebration or relaxation onboard.
